Transaction 07e30496efdc92c1fececef4cf11c3ef25d74116ca0299c08cb78ba3fabf7df0

1 Input
2 Outputs
  • 07e30496efdc92c1fececef4cf11c3ef25d74116ca0299c08cb78ba3fabf7df0:0
  • value  348053
    address  1DdHgKz9PeReDNbLyD3S4cgXrg2KgGqWnT
  • 07e30496efdc92c1fececef4cf11c3ef25d74116ca0299c08cb78ba3fabf7df0:1
  • value  19074630
    address  1LDMahhDUdfRHYXV5o22ojZS1gG7GQRw2f